There is an interesting rumor coming out in regards to the potential sale of Take-Two or just their 2K Sports division. Originally posted by the site Xbox Family, there is some talk that Microsoft could buy 2K Sports and resurrect the Xbox Sports Network through the 2K games. They could then expand to other sports as well.

The Xbox Sports Network was introduced with the original Xbox and included games such as NFL Fever and NBA Inside Drive.

In this scenario Microsoft would then have their own exclusive line of sports titles on the 360 in the same way that Sony has theirs. 2K Sports has continued to struggle with profitability which has lead to widespread belief that Take-Two would like to get that division off their hands.

Despite how some people want to jump on the pure speculation of an EA purchase of 2K there is nothing currently that points towards that being a reality.

Would Microsoft find value in this deal? Having exclusive franchises is always appealing, although it is uncertain whether they would really want to go head-to-head with EA. It’ll be an interesting situation to follow.
